BUT!!!!!...... if it has ever been been rebuilt with factory parts but to blueprinted specs then it will be a true 11.25 static compression motor that with iron heads will not last on the street on 93 octane!!!
Iron head BB motors must be down to at least 10.5 real static compression to run on pump gas on the street.
